Can Guizhi Poria Pill, Vajrapani Capsule and Gynecological Hemostasis Tablet be taken together?

Gui Zhi Fu Ling Pill has the effects of activating blood circulation, resolving blood stasis and eliminating symptoms (eliminating lumps in the abdomen), and is used for treating abdominal pain during menstruation, menstrual stasis (menstrual shutdown due to stagnation of blood), persistent lumps in the body, and incomplete evacuation of evil dews after giving birth. It is contraindicated in pregnant women and should be discontinued in menstruating women. Adverse reactions of gastric discomfort and vague pain may occur after use.
With the efficacy of clearing heat and removing toxins, resolving dampness and eliminating swelling, Adamantine Capsule is mainly used for treating abdominal pain during menstruation, profuse and yellowish thick symptoms caused by dampness-heat underflow (dampness and heat invading the intestines, bladder, pubic region, lower limbs, etc.), and chronic pelvic inflammatory disease, adnexitis or adnexal inflammatory masses accompanied by the above mentioned symptoms. It is contraindicated in pregnant women, and the adverse effects of the drug are not clear at the moment.
Gynecological Hemostasis Tablet has the effect of tonifying the kidney and astringing the yin, fixing the impulses and stopping bleeding, and is mainly used for treating functional uterine bleeding in women. Contraindications and adverse reactions are not clear.
Among the above three drugs, Gui Zhi Fu Ling Pill and Gynecological Hemostasis Tablet are mutually exclusive in efficacy, so concurrent use is not recommended. Specific use of drugs should be under the guidance of a specialist, not unauthorized use of drugs.
